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.03.10;
Скачать: CL | DM;

Вниз

Обновление у клиентов   Найти похожие ветки 

 
Sherbacov ©   (2003-02-17 18:00) [0]

Есть 2 клиента(использую Table, BDE), надо если один пользователь добавил запись в таблицу, чтобы она появлялась у все клиентов автоматически. Как это сделать?


 
Mike Kouzmine   (2003-02-17 18:12) [1]

Refresh


 
mate ©   (2003-02-17 18:18) [2]

Отсылай широковещательный пакет через сокеты и по принятии такого пакета делай Refresh. Либо делай общение через файл либо через какую-нибудь запись в таблице.


 
Sherbacov ©   (2003-02-17 18:44) [3]

Проблема, Refresh не работает, только после закрытия и открытия таблицы
Я также использую TSession.


 
Виталий Панасенко   (2003-02-18 08:57) [4]

BDEAdmin-Configuration-Init-LOCAL SHARE=TRUE. Ведь один из компов сервер, не так ли ?:-)
Если честно, то этого достаточно кажись только на сервере сделать, хотя рекомендуют везде.


 
bolega   (2003-02-18 16:33) [5]

Проблема, Refresh не работает, только после закрытия и открытия таблицы

А если посмотреть глубже, Refresh по сути не есть ли
закрытие/открытие (т.е. полное перечитывание данных)?


 
AndrewLight   (2003-02-19 20:05) [6]

Действительно интересный вопрос, а если это еще и несколько таблиц. В свою очередь пробовал поставить таймер и через некоторое время проверять данные на обновляемость, через промежуточную таблицу индикатор (в этой тбл. указывал какая таблица меняется), и хотя это и работает, но не знаю как-то это кривовато.


 
VAleksey ©   (2003-02-20 06:35) [7]

Вариант с широковещательным пакетом весьма привлекателен ИМХО.

> Виталий Панасенко (18.02.03 08:57)

Local Share = true на всех клиентских машинах.

> bolega (18.02.03 16:33)

А если посмотреть еще глубже то не совсем.



Страницы: 1 вся ветка

Текущий архив: 2003.03.10;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.016 c
3-29759
Лёша
2003-02-17 18:13
2003.03.10
Кто работал с BTRIEV из DELPHI?


3-29727
asusfi
2003-02-18 17:22
2003.03.10
ТРАНЗАКЦИИ НА СЕРВЕРЕ


3-29706
Anubis
2003-02-18 14:37
2003.03.10
Ячейка DBGrid


14-30090
Случайный прохожий
2003-02-22 02:21
2003.03.10
Всё! Первый


3-29717
Alex Y
2003-02-19 06:56
2003.03.10
Один коннект из нескольких dll или временные таблицы